§626.  Articles of incorporation; by-law provisions

No policy shall contain any provision purporting to make any portion of the articles of incorporation, by-laws, or other constituent document of the insurer a part of the contract unless such portion is set forth in full in the policy.  Any policy provision in violation of this Section shall be invalid.  

Acts 1958, No. 125.
